SODIUM ALUMINATE
Characteristics: Sodium aluminate is found as a white powder.
Solubility: Soluble in water, not soluble in alcohol.
Sodium aluminate solution is strongly alkaline in nature.
Melting Point: 1800°C
Grades: Technical and reagent grades
Precautions: Its solution is poisonous.
Uses:
- Soap and detergent manufacturing
- In paper sizing
- In the textile industry as a mordant
- Milk glass manufacturing
- Cleaning compound manufacturing
